AMD GPUs

Native AMD GPUs

Kext cần thiết:

Support

  • Version cao nhất: Bản mới nhất

  • Version thấp nhất: MacOS Monterey

Supported Cards:

  • RX 6600

  • RX 6600 XT

Hầu hết card Navi 23 đều cần boot-arg agdpmod=pikera để có thể xuất hình

Chú ý rằng đối với dòng RX 6600

Nếu bạn bị black screen ngay cả khi đã add arg agdpmod=pikera thì bạn sẽ tiến hành làm như sau để fix lỗi

  • Xoá những boot-arg -v debug=0x100 keepsyms=1

  • Setting những dòng sau trong Misc -> Debug

    • AppleDebug = False

    • ApplePanic = False

    • DisableWatchDog = True

    • Target = 0

Kext cần thiết:

Support

  • Version cao nhất: Bản mới nhất

  • Version thấp nhất: MacOS Monterey

Supported Cards:

  • RX 6700

  • RX 6700 XT

Support

  • Version cao nhất: Bản mới nhất

  • Version thấp nhất: MacOS BigSur

Supported Cards:

  • RX 6800

  • RX 6800 XT

  • RX 6900 XT

    • Các dòng card có đuôi XTXH variant có Device ID: 0x73AF

      • Thì được support với WhateverGreen varsion 1.5.2 và cần fake device-id thành0x73BF.

Hầu hết card Navi 21 đều cần boot-arg agdpmod=pikera để có thể xuất hình

Support

  • Version cao nhất: Bản mới nhất

  • Version thấp nhất: MacOS Catalina

Supported Cards:

  • RX 5500

  • RX 5500 XT

  • RX 5600

  • RX 5600 XT

  • RX 5700

  • RX 5700 XT

  • RX 5700 XT 50th Anniversary Edition

Radeon Pro:

  • Radeon Pro W5500

  • Radeon Pro W5700

Hầu hết card Navi 10 và 14 đều cần boot-arg agdpmod=pikera để có thể xuất hình

Ghi chú cho MSI Navi users

  • Từ MacOS catalina trở xuống các vbios của dòng này sẽ gây lỗi trong quá trình cài đặt

  • Nó có thể được giải quyết bởi ATY,Rom# trong device properties với bất kì vaule nào

  • Dòng Vega và Polaris của AMD không bị ảnh hưởng bởi lỗi này

Vega 20 series

Support:

  • Version cao nhất: Bản mới nhất

  • Version thấp nhất: MacOS Mojave

Supported Cards:

  • Radeon VII

Vega 10 series

Support:

  • Version cao nhất: Bản mới nhất

  • Version thấp nhất: MacOS High Sierra

Nếu muốn ép xung hãy tham khảo tại đây

Dòng duy nhất bạn cần tránh với Vega 10 đó chính là XFX Do dòng này có vbios gây lỗi cho quá trình cài đặt

Supported Cards:

  • Vega 64 Liquid

  • Vega 64

  • Vega 56

Radeon Pro:

  • Vega Frontier Edition

  • Radeon Pro WX 9100

Polaris 10 and 20 series

Support:

  • Version cao nhất: Bản mới nhất

  • Version thấp nhất: MacOS Sierra

Về Polaris cơ bản mọi loại card đều được hỗ trợ miễn là nó có core là Polaris hoặc Baffin. Nếu bạn có card sử dụng core là Lexa thì bạn có thể cần spoof device-id

Các dòng card Polaris bạn nên tránh là XFX (460/560 models), PowerColor, HIS và VisionTek.

Nhiều người nói họ gặp sự cô với những dòng card trên có thể là do vbios của những dòng card này bị lỗi. Đã có nhiều người fix được nhưng đó là bằng những cách khác nhau không nhất quán. Bạn có thể thử flash một vbios khác cho con card của mình

Supported cards:

400 Series:

  • RX 480

  • RX 470D

  • RX 470

  • RX 460

500 Series:

  • RX 590

  • RX 580X

  • RX 580

  • RX 570X

  • RX 570

  • RX 560X

  • RX 560

  • RX 550 (Baffin core)

Radeon Pro:

  • WX 7100

  • WX 5100

  • WX 4100

  • E9550

Nếu như bạn đang sử dụng card AMD RX 580 2048SP thì bạn sẽ cần phải flash vbios của RX 570

R7/R9

Support:

  • Version cao nhất: MacOS Monterey

  • Version thấp nhất: OS X Yosemite

R7/R9 cũng được hỗ trợ native tuy nhiên có rất ít người feedback là thành công với card này. Nhìn chung trong mã R7/R9 dòng Sapphire là khả quan nhất

Ngoài ra R9 280X/380X cũng bị lỗi về khả năng tương thích

Supported cards:

  • R9 Fury X

  • R9 Fury

  • R9 Nano

  • R9 390 (Fake ID needed)

  • R9 290X/390X

  • R9 290/390 (Fake ID needed)

  • R9 280X/380X (Hit or miss)

  • R9 280/380 (Fake ID needed)

  • R9 270X/370X

  • R7 270/370 (Fake ID needed)

  • R7 265

  • R7 260X/360X

  • R9 260/360 (Fake ID may be required depending on model)

  • R9 255

  • R7 250X

  • R7 250 (Fake ID needed)

  • R7 240 (Fake ID needed)

Chú ý:

HD 7730/7750/7770/R7 250/R7 250X GPU cần boot-arg radpg=15

Còn boot-arg -raddvi giúp fix cổng DVI và cần thiết cho 290X, 370,....

Một số mã card mình có để dòng Fake ID needed tức là những mã đó cần fake device-id

HD 8000 Series (8xxx)

Support:

  • Version cao nhất: MacOS Monterey

  • Version thấp nhất: OS X Mountain Lion

Supported cards:

  • Dual AMD FirePro D300

  • Dual AMD FirePro D500

  • Dual AMD FirePro D700

  • FirePro W5100 (Fake ID needed)

  • FirePro W7000

  • FirePro W9000

  • HD 7700

  • HD 7730

  • HD 7750

  • HD 7770

  • HD 7790

  • HD 7850

  • HD 7870

  • HD 7870 XT

  • HD 7950

  • HD 7970

  • HD 7990

HD 7000 Series (7xxx)

Support

  • Version cao nhất MacOS Monterey

  • Version thấp nhất OS X Mountain Lion

Supported cards:

  • Dual AMD FirePro D300

  • Dual AMD FirePro D500

  • Dual AMD FirePro D700

  • FirePro W5100 (Fake ID needed)

  • FirePro W7000

  • FirePro W9000

  • HD 7700

  • HD 7730

  • HD 7750

  • HD 7770

  • HD 7790

  • HD 7850

  • HD 7870

  • HD 7870 XT

  • HD 7950

  • HD 7970

  • HD 7990

Chú ý:

HD 7730/7750/7770/R7 250/R7 250X GPU cần boot-arg radpg=15

AMD APUs

Support

  • Version cao nhất: Bản mới nhất

  • Version thấp nhất: MacOS BigSur

Chú ý

Bạn hãy nhớ rằng với AMD APU bạn không được sử dụng WhateverGreen.kext

  • 1xxx to 5xxx series

    • Ví dụ: AMD Ryzen™ 7 5700G

    • Hoặc ví dụ khác: AMD Ryzen™ 3 3200G

  • 7x30 series

    • Ví dụ: AMD Ryzen™ 3 7330U

Unsupported AMD GPUs

Các trong các mã Navi chỉ có Navi 21, Navi 22 và Navi 23 được hỗ trợ

Navi 24 và Navi 3X đều không hỗ trợ tại thời điểm viết bài

Unsupported Cards:

  • RX 7900 XTX

  • RX 7900 XT

  • RX 6750 XT

  • RX 6500 XT

  • RX 6400

Lexa Series

Tuy nhiên bạn có theêr thử fake device-id để patch nó

Unsupported Cards:

  • WX 3100

  • WX 2100

  • RX 550X (Lexa core)

  • RX 550 (Lexa core)

  • RX 540X

  • RX 540

AMD APUs

Các APU còn lại so với các APU đã liệt kê ở trên đều không support ở thời điểm hiện tại

Source tham khảo: https://dortania.github.io/GPU-Buyers-Guide/modern-gpus/amd-gpu.html

Last updated